Linux 2.6.x on MPC52xx family¶
For the latest info, go tohttps://www.246tNt.com/mpc52xx/
To compile/use :
U-Boot:
# <edit Makefile to set ARCH=ppc & CROSS_COMPILE=... ( also EXTRAVERSION if you wish to ).# make lite5200_defconfig# make uImagethen, on U-boot:=> tftpboot 200000 uImage=> tftpboot 400000 pRamdisk=> bootm 200000 400000DBug:
# <edit Makefile to set ARCH=ppc & CROSS_COMPILE=... ( also EXTRAVERSION if you wish to ).# make lite5200_defconfig# cp your_initrd.gz arch/ppc/boot/images/ramdisk.image.gz# make zImage.initrd# makethen in DBug:DBug> dn -i zImage.initrd.lite5200
Some remarks:
- The port is named mpc52xxx, and config options are PPC_MPC52xx. The MGT5100is not supported, and I’m not sure anyone is interesting in working on itso. I didn’t took 5xxx because there’s apparently a lot of 5xxx that havenothing to do with the MPC5200. I also included the ‘MPC’ for the samereason.
